St George Illawarra Dragons have confirmed their coaching staff for the 2021 NRL season.

The club, who last month confirmed Anthony Griffin as head coach, have added Peter Gentle and Matthew Elliott as assistant coaches.

Current interim Brisbane Broncos coach Peter Gentle joins the club with over 15 years of first grade coaching experience having previously acted as head coach of Hull FC (2012-13) as well as an assistant at the Sharks, Wests Tigers, Parramatta Eels and South Sydney Rabbitohs.

Elliot also has 16 seasons of head coaching experience alone having last coached the New Zealand Warriors in 2014. His 18 months at the Warriors followed long stints at the Bradford Bulls, Canberra Raiders and Penrith Panthers.

General manager of football Ben Haran said: “Change was inevitable for our football department heading into the 2021 season following the appointment of Anthony Griffin.

“We are pleased with the personnel that will join the Dragons in preparation for our 2021 campaign, and how they will connect under the new structure we have put in place.”
